操作系统虚拟环境搭建:如何创建安全的测试平台

时间:2025-12-06 分类:操作系统

搭建一个安全的操作系统虚拟环境,是现代软件开发与测试中不可忽视的重要环节。这种虚拟化技术可以为开发者和测试人员提供一个可控的实验平台,避免了直接操作真实系统可能带来的风险和不稳定性。无论是进行软件测试、恶意程序分析,还是进行系统配置实验,虚拟环境都能够提供高度的灵活性与安全保障。本文将详细探讨如何创建一个高效且安全的测试平台,确保测试过程高效且避免对主系统的影响,以便实现开发和测试的兼容与安全。

操作系统虚拟环境搭建:如何创建安全的测试平台

选择合适的虚拟化软件是搭建测试平台的第一步。目前市场上有多种虚拟化工具可供选择,例如VMware、VirtualBox和KVM等。这些工具各具特点,用户可根据自身需求选择合适的解决方案。安装虚拟化软件时,需确保系统满足其要求,以便获得最佳性能。定期检查软件更新和补丁也是保持虚拟环境安全的重要措施。

创建虚拟机时,需要合理配置硬件资源,包括CPU、内存和存储空间等。过低的配置可能导致系统性能不足,而过高的配置则会浪费资源。建议根据测试需求,并保持一定的灵活性,适时调整资源配置。将虚拟机的快照功能合理利用可以对系统进行多次恢复,极大地提升测试的便利性和安全性。

在虚拟环境中,网络配置也是一个关键因素。设置独立的虚拟网络可以有效隔离虚拟机与外界网络,从而减少潜在的安全风险。在进行安全测试时,务必保持系统处于良好的隔离状态,以避免因恶意软件引发的意外数据泄露或攻击。应用防火墙和其他安全工具也是必要的步骤,以增强虚拟环境的安全性。

做好备份和恢复计划至关重要。建立定期备份机制,可以避免数据丢失及系统崩溃等情况对工作造成的影响。在需要测试新软件或配置时,可以随时恢复到之前的稳定状态,从而保证测试的高效性和准确性。通过这些措施,可以有效搭建起一个安全、稳定的操作系统虚拟环境,助力软件开发和测试的顺利进行。